modular_api/models/user_model.py (38 lines of code) (raw):
import os
from pynamodb.attributes import UnicodeAttribute, ListAttribute, MapAttribute
from modular_api.helpers.constants import Env
from modular_api.helpers.date_utils import convert_datetime_to_human_readable
from modular_api.models import BaseModel
from modular_api.helpers.utilities import recursive_sort
class User(BaseModel):
class Meta:
table_name = 'ModularUser'
region = os.environ.get(Env.AWS_REGION)
username = UnicodeAttribute(hash_key=True)
groups = ListAttribute(default=list)
password = UnicodeAttribute()
state = UnicodeAttribute()
state_reason = UnicodeAttribute(null=True)
last_modification_date = UnicodeAttribute(null=True)
creation_date = UnicodeAttribute(null=True)
meta = MapAttribute(default=dict)
hash = UnicodeAttribute()
def response_object_without_hash(self) -> dict:
user_meta = {
'username': self.username,
'groups': self.groups,
'password': self.password,
'state': self.state,
'state_reason': self.state_reason,
'last_modification_date': convert_datetime_to_human_readable(
datetime_object=self.last_modification_date
),
'creation_date': convert_datetime_to_human_readable(
datetime_object=self.creation_date
)
}
# Meta must be sorted as different order can generate different hash
# deep sort for nested hash compatibility
if self.meta:
meta_dict = self.meta.as_dict()
sorted_meta = recursive_sort(meta_dict)
user_meta.update({'meta': sorted_meta})
return user_meta
